John B. Graves was born at Washington, DC.
He witnessed the will of Peter Gilbert Meem on 12 November 1880 at Office Register of Wills, Washington, DC; Will of Peter Gilbert Meem- Proved Jan 14, 1881- Office Register of Wills, District of Columbia- Recorded: A. W. No. 18, Folio 372 (Transcribed by: Cecil A. Jamison, Jr. - 09/28/2003) I Peter G. Meem of Georgetown in the District of Columbia, being weak in body but sound and disposing mind memory and understanding, do make publish and declare this to be my last will and testament: First: I direct that all my just debts and funeral expenses be promptly paid. Second: I give and devise to my two sisters Elizabeth J. Meem and Lucy Meem in fee simple, to be equally divided between them, share alike, my one undivided sixth interest and estate in the following named two pieces of real estate in said Georgetown: Viz: in the house and lot on Green Street used by my said sisters as a family home and which they now reside and in the house and lot on Bank Alley, belonging to the heirs at law of my father, the late John Meem, and which two pieces of real estate are more particularly set forth and described in the deed of conveyance made by my brother James G. Meem, to my said sisters on the 13th of February 1874, and recorded in Liber No. 739, Folio 255 .. of the Land Records of said District. Third: I give and devise to my said two sisters Elizabeth J. Meem and Lucy Meem in trust for my two children M. Gilbert Meem and Harry G. Meem in fee simple all the rest and residue of my estate, real and personal of every kind and description, including my house and lot on Green Street which was conveyed to me by Margaret Meem and others, by deed dated the 19th of December 1867, and recorded in Liber E.E.E No. 26, Folio 359, one of the Land Records of the District, to be equally divided between said two children, share and share alike, when the youngest of said two children arrives at the age of twenty one, and upon the death of either one of the said children, before arriving at the said age of twenty one, the share of such one so dying shall vest in and become the share and estate of the survivor of said children, and upon the death of both of my said two children before arriving at said age of twenty one years, then the whole of their estate so devised to them as before said shall vest in and become the estate of my said two sisters Elizabeth J. Meem and Lucy Meem, in fee simple, to be equally divided between them, share and share alike. Lastly: I constitute and appoint my said two sisters Elizabeth J. Meem and Lucy Meem Executors of this my last will and testament. Witness my hand and said this 28th day of June AD Eighteen Hundred and Twenty-six. P.G. Meem (Seal) Signed, Sealed, Published and Declared by the said Testator, Peter G. Meem as and for his last will and testament, in our presence, who at his request, in his presence and in the presence of each other have set our names as witnesses hereto: (James W.) J.W. Deeble Thomas Dowling (Jno.) J.B. Graves.1 |

Horace M. Deeble was born at Washington, DC.
He witnessed the will of Margaret Meem on 6 November 1873 at Supreme Court of the District of Columbia, Washington, DC; Transcribed Will of Margaret Meem, Recorded in Will Book # 14, folio# 93, Filed November 18, 1873 with the Office Register of Wills, District of Columbia, transcribed by: Cecil A. (Sandy) Jamison, Jr. April 26, 2004. I Margaret Meem, of the City of Georgetown, in the District of Columbia, being of sound mind and memory, do hereby make, ordain, publish and declare this to be my last Will and Testament. That is to say, after my lawful debts and funeral expenses are paid and discharged, the residue of my estate, real and personal, I give and bequeath to my two daughters, Elizabeth Jane Meem and Lucy Meem, to be equally divided between them, share and share alike. I likewise hereby constitute and appoint my daughter Elizabeth Jane Meem to be the Executor of this my Last Will and Testament. In witness whereof, I have hereunto subscribed my hand and affixed my seal, this sixth day of November, in the year of our Lord One Thousand Eight Hundred and Seventy-Three. Margaret Meem (seal) The above written instrument was subscribed by the said Margaret Meem in our presence and acknowledged by her to each of us and she at the same time published and declared the above instrument, so subscribed, to be her last Will and Testament, and we, at the testators request, and in her presence, and in the presence of each other, have signed our names as witnesses hereto, and written opposite our names our respective places of residence. James M. Deeble Georgetown, DC Horace H.M. (?) Deeble " " " " Peter G. Meem  ."1 " " " |

| Archbishop John Carroll was born on 8 January 1735 at Maryland. He was the son of Daniel Carroll of Upper Marlboro I and Eleanor Darnall.1 Archbishop John Carroll was buried in December 1815 at Montgomery County, Maryland. He died on 3 December 1815 at Baltimore, Maryland, at age 80. He He was the first Catholic Bishop of the 13 British Colonies and the first Archbishop of Baltimore. |

| Charles Carroll was born on 22 March 1723 at From "Find a Grave-Ancestry.Com", Annapolis, Anne Arundel County, Maryland. He died on 23 March 1783 at From "Find a Grave- Ancestry.Com", Baltimore, Baltimore County, Maryland, at age 60. He Revolutionary War Continental Congressman. Helped write and frame Maryland's "Declaration of Rights" which the State adopted on November 3, 1776. Elected as a Delegate from Maryland to the Continental Congress, serving from Nov. 1776 to Feb. 19777. He was the cousin of Declaration of Indenpendence Signer Charles Carroll, and of Maryland Congressman Daniel Carroll. (Bio by "Russ Dodge:). |
